logo

Output 68f6e67b6c9961f02ec591d1d8ea22f33c725e5f967411a743ec0551846e5de6:0

value
7598661
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4405d68d1b171ac11dea4466778d7b4ec639284 OP_EQUAL
address
3KahUHwKdmdvedjzGLTthWBKj7t6pN5wp6
transaction
68f6e67b6c9961f02ec591d1d8ea22f33c725e5f967411a743ec0551846e5de6